Output 570c405aa21acc3d2852519552f82b1c645cd1dd87ec408f2002eba08cd8002e:6

value
17864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2c3af692758c0ee575d795dfda2ca4ce4cc39b OP_EQUAL
address
3HZxV6hccfdpJes5LP4ZxfiKFJVxdxYNkR
transaction
570c405aa21acc3d2852519552f82b1c645cd1dd87ec408f2002eba08cd8002e
spent
true